Heroin King of Baltimore: The Rise and Fall of Melvin Williams

Money… injustice… redemption

Baltimore City officials asked drug kingpin Melvin Williams to stop the riots happened following Martin Luther King's assassination. After helping the authorities out, Williams was then labeled a threat, framed and incarcerated by a hypocritical society.
